Sunday in Bangkok
Is Sunday any different than Saturday in Bangkok? Meaning, are stores closed? hours shorter? What can I expect? I am travelling to Koh Samui and have the choice of spending a Saturday or a Saturday and Sunday in BKK and I wonder if the extra day will be a wash if things are closed.

i think you will find issolated store closings in bkk on sundays but very few as kathie says....there is the weekend market too if you are interested....lots of hotels have fabulous sunday bruches....i particularily like the indian one at the rembrandt hotel....
